i may be premature here dipping my toes into financials. AXP got spanked pretty hard for revealing what we already knew: people are having trouble paying their bills. i looked at the charts over many different time periods, looked at the financials, looked at the investors who hold shares, and thought about the overall economic picture. i think i am in at a good price if we experience a quick short downturn here. if it is a more protracted and painful one, i think my downside risk is limited. i reserve the right to change my mind on a dime though ;-)

well, not quite that negligent in the due diligence department. there are a lot of reasons to own ebay right now i think, although the tiffany lawsuit is definitely casting a shadow at the moment. and if the economy really tanks then the story might not make sense, but my thesis is that auctions are popular when people are feeling pinched. they look for cheaper alternatives to buying retail, and they head out to the garage to unload all the crap they bought when they refi'ed.

moving to dividends, as a move towards safety. the large weighting of finance companies in this ETF worries me a little in this climate, but the sector has been hammered pretty well already, and it looks like no one company represents much more than 2% of the holdings. the chart looked good as well. and phil pointed this one out http://www.philstockworld.com/2007/08/22/wild-wednesday-morning-3/
